Summary

The purpose of this study involved investigating the effects of daily ingested wild blueberry drink (22.5 g wild blueberry powder added to pineapple juice) for 8 weeks on movement of people diagnosed with Parkinson's disease. Specifically, the investigators questioned:

* Do the movements of people with Parkinson's disease improve after ingesting the blueberry drink once a day for 8 weeks?
* Do the movements of people with Parkinson's disease after ingesting the blueberry drink show benefits compared to people with Parkinson's ingesting a placebo drink?

Participants will:

* Drink blueberry drink or placebo once a day for 8 weeks
* Visit the neurologist before and after the intervention period
* Complete assessments before and after the intervention period
* Visit the lab weekly for checkups and to obtain more powder and juice
* Keep a diary of time of ingestion and adverse effects. The investigators hypothesized that supplementation with wild blueberry powder will result in favorable improvements in movements in people with Parkinson's disease that exceed placebo supplementation.

Interventions

DIETARY_SUPPLEMENT

Wild blueberry powder

Experimental (BB): The experimental powder consists freeze-dried wild blueberry powder included quick frozen and dehydrated wild blueberries to reduce the moisture content to approximately 2-4%. Added to 6oz of pineapple juice.

OTHER

Placebo

Placebo Comparator (Placebo): Placebo drink consists of matched nutritional properties minus the polyphenols for BB powder. Added to 6oz of pineapple juice.
